加入收藏 | 设为首页 | 会员中心 | 我要投稿 52站长网 (https://www.52zhanzhang.com/)- 视频服务、内容创作、业务安全、云计算、数据分析!
当前位置: 首页 > 服务器 > 搭建环境 > Linux > 正文

Linux小程序开发:高效测试工程师的工具链搭建指南

发布时间:2026-02-07 08:04:06 所属栏目:Linux 来源:DaWei
导读:  在Linux环境下进行小程序开发,测试工程师需要一套高效且可靠的工具链来提升工作效率。选择合适的开发工具和测试框架是第一步,这不仅影响代码的编写效率,也决定了测试的自动化程度。  Vim或Emacs等轻量级编辑

  在Linux环境下进行小程序开发,测试工程师需要一套高效且可靠的工具链来提升工作效率。选择合适的开发工具和测试框架是第一步,这不仅影响代码的编写效率,也决定了测试的自动化程度。


  Vim或Emacs等轻量级编辑器适合快速编写代码,配合插件如Linter、Code Completion可以显著提升编码体验。同时,使用Git进行版本控制,确保代码的可追溯性和协作效率。


AI生成内容图,仅供参考

  对于测试工作,Python的unittest或pytest框架是常见的选择,它们支持单元测试、集成测试等多种测试类型。结合Jenkins或GitHub Actions,可以实现持续集成,让测试流程自动化。


  调试工具如gdb或valgrind能帮助定位内存泄漏或逻辑错误,而Wireshark则可用于网络请求的抓包分析。这些工具的组合使用,使问题排查更加高效。


  容器化技术如Docker能够提供一致的测试环境,避免因环境差异导致的“本地能跑,线上报错”问题。配合Kubernetes,还能模拟生产环境的复杂部署结构。


  文档和日志管理同样重要。使用Markdown编写技术文档,配合Sphinx生成API文档,有助于团队知识共享。而syslog、rsyslog等日志系统,则为问题追踪提供了可靠依据。

(编辑:52站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章